Misted double glazed glass units glazing

If your double-glazed windows develop mist, it can be very unsightly and affect the clarity of your view from the window. This can also indicate that your windows aren't sealed or well-insulated. This can lead to expensive energy bills as you will need to heat your house more to keep it warm. Double glazing that has misted can be repaired for a reasonable price.

The cause of misting in double glazed windows is actually condensation which builds up between the two panes of glass that comprise your double glazing. This is a common problem and is caused by a variety of causes. Typically, this happens when the air in the room becomes too humid, leading to water vapour in the air condensing on cold surfaces. It can also occur when the seals or glass fail. In any situation, it could be a real hassle and is worth fixing when you detect it.

A cloudy appearance in the middle of the window is a sign that the double glazing is clouded. This is usually caused by the build-up of water between the glass panes and can be difficult to remove. Try wiping the inside of the glass with a moist cloth to see if that helps.

Broken panes

It is best to clean your double-glazed window at least once a year with mild soap. Avoid harsh chemicals that can cause damage to the seals. Never use a high pressure washer on your windows because the water could get inside the sash, leading to leaks. If you decide to use chemicals, be sure they're safe and use them only sparingly.

If you have a broken pane in your window It is crucial to get it fixed quickly. It's not just dangerous, but it can affect the efficiency of your home's energy use and result in higher utility bills. A defective window will allow cold air to enter your home, and warm heat escape, which can result in significant energy loss.

It's not too difficult to fix damaged or cracked windows however it will take some time and effort. First, you'll need to take off the old glass and glazing points. This can be done using a putty knife, pliers, or a thin screwdriver with a flat head. Wearing eye protection, carefully pry the old glazing points from the window frame's recesses. Once the old glass is gone, scrape down the L-shaped channel that runs around the edges of the window frame. Then, sand any unfinished wood to a smooth surface and seal it with linseed oil or a clear wood sealer.

The next step is cutting the glass replacement to size. You can use either the template on paper with a pencil or the edge of a pane that is intact as a reference. Then you can use the glass cutter to cut the new glass and a sharp blade to take out the fragments. One of the most common issues with double-glazed windows is that they can create condensation between the panes of glass. This could be due to a variety of reasons, including a inadequate ventilation and high humidity in the building or room. In order to prevent condensation, you should keep the humidity at a minimum and make use of vents or extractors in the window frames to let fresh air to enter the space.

If you're experiencing condensation or draughts it is likely that the seal on your double-glazed window has failed. A damaged seal can cause a loss of insulation and will increase your heating bills. If you're not sure whether your seals have failed or not, rub your fingers across the window frame to determine whether it's cold and drafty. This can be a sign that the seals have worn out and the Desiccant inside the sealed unit has become saturated.

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gDesiccant is a specific material that absorbs moisture from the air. When the Desiccant is saturated, it will break down. White snowflakes of dust can be seen floating around the sealed unit. This is a clear indication that the seals are failing and that a replacement unit is required.
